Kerala Rains: IMD Issues Red, Orange & Yellow Alerts for Several Districts

The India Meteorological Department (IMD) issued red alerts for four districts in Kerala on Monday, December 2, cautioning of isolated heavy rainfall in the state.

The four northern districts of Kerala, Malappuram, Kozhikode, Wayanad, and Kannur are forecasted to experience extremely heavy rainfall.

Rainfall activity will increase, with light to moderate rainfall at most places, heavy to very heavy rainfall at a few places, and extremely heavy rainfall at isolated locations on December 2, followed by heavy rainfall at isolated places on December 3,” the weather department said.

Meanwhile, an orange alert” has been issued for the districts of Kottayam, Ernakulam, Idukki, and Thrissur, while a “yellow alert” has been placed for Pathanamthitta, Alappuzha, Palakkad, Malappuram, Kozhikode, Wayanad, Kannur, and Kasaragod.

Farmers’ Protest March from Delhi-NCR Today, Here’s What They Are Demanding

A group of farmers is set to march towards Delhi on Monday, December 02. Sukhbir Khalifa, leader of the Bhartiya Kisan Parishad (BKP), confirmed the farmers’ plans, stating that they are ready to march towards Delhi.

The protest march comes ahead of the scheduled protest march to Delhi by other farmer organisations, including the Kisan Mazdoor Morcha (KMM) and the Samyukt Kisan Morcha (SKM), from December 6.

Khalifa said, “Tomorrow, on December 2, we will begin our journey from beneath the Mahamaya flyover at 12 pm, where we will gather and demand compensation and benefits according to the new laws.”

The key demands of the farmers, who will commence a protest march towards Delhi from Haryana and Punjab, include compensation demands, benefits under the new agricultural laws, and a guaranteed Minimum Support Price (MSP).
